John Curry (History) was appointed to a three-to-five-year term on , which is administered to hundreds of thousands of high school students each year. This committee represents a unique collaboration between high school and college educators, and is made up of six key appointees, drawn from the university and secondary education community across the entire United States. The committee plays a critical role in the preparation of the course description and exam for the world history field. Representing different points of view, the committee is viewed as the authority when it comes to making subject-matter decisions in the exam-construction process. Curry will represent the knowledge base for the Islamic World and its surrounding linkages.
